Jfritz an Asterisk anstelle Fritzbox

Status
Für weitere Antworten geschlossen.

Tippfehler

IPPF-Promi
Mitglied seit
14 Sep 2004
Beiträge
3,271
Punkte für Reaktionen
29
Punkte
48
Hallo,
es Widerspricht zwar dem Namen, aber müßte doch irgendwie zu machen sein.
Ist es möglich, Asterisk dazu zu bewegen, die Anrufdaten, die die Fritzbox auf Port 1012 sendet, auch selbst zu erzeugen und zu senden?
Mein Problem ist, dass ich ein paar SIP-Telefone habe, die direkt über Asterisk rauswählen. Davon bekommt die Fritzbox und damit auch JFritz leider nichts mit.

Es werden solche Daten, wie z.B.
Code:
04.12.09 11:47:04;CALL;1,10,12345;0123456789;SIP4;
04.12.09 11:47:04;CONNECT;1;10;0123456789;
04.12.09 11:47:10;DISCONNECT;1;2;
auf dem Port gesendet.
Das müßte man doch auch irgendwie in den Asterisk-Dialplan einbauen können.
Weiß Jemand, wie man beim Asterisk auf der Fritzbox Daten auf Port 1012 senden kann?
Vermutlich ist es ein ganz einfacher Befehl, den ich aber als Nicht-Programmierer leider noch nicht kenne. Auch Google hat mir nicht weiter helfen können. Den Befehl listen, ... findet man überall, aber ich brauche das Gegenstück dazu.
(Mir reicht die direkte Anzeige auf dem Bildschirm, um die gewählte Rufnummer überprüfen zu können, eine Anzeige in der Anrufliste wäre zwar auch schön, ist aber sicher etwas komplizierter.)

Für einen Tipp wäre ich sehr dankbar.
 
Zuletzt bearbeitet:
Man könnte ein Programm schreiben, dass mittels AGI vom Asterisk aufgerufen werden kann und diese Daten auf dem Port ausgibt.

Hast du php, java oder ähnliches auf deinem Asterisk-Server installiert? Damit könnte man sicherlich etwas basteln.

Eventuell findest du im Asterisk-Forum bessere Hilfe als im JFritz-Forum.

Gruß,
Robert
 
Mein Asterisk ist auf der Fritzbox, da gibt es so etwas leider nicht.
Es gibt aber ein Asterisk-Manager-Interface. Da werden Daten über Port 5038 versendet. Die müßte man irgendwie übersetzen.
Ich probiere es mal in einem anderen Foren-Bereich.
Danke für die schnelle Rückmeldung.
 
@Tippfehler

Falls Du in der Sache etwas heraus bekommst, würde mich das auch brennend interessieren. Vielleicht könnte man einfach netcat (nc) per System() Befehl ansprechen, dann könnte das auch auf embedded Lösungen funktionieren.

Code:
echo "blablabla" | nc host port
 
Ja, so habe ich mir das vorgestellt, leider funktioniert es nicht.
Immerhin ist nc bei der BusyBox enthalten, vielleicht ist es einfach ein Syntax-Problem.

Ich habe auch mal hier die Frage gestellt, weil dieser Programmierer schon mit einem ähnlichen Programm angefangen hat.
http://www.ip-phone-forum.de/showthread.php?p=1441469
 
Zuletzt bearbeitet:
Status
Für weitere Antworten geschlossen.
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.